MADISON PARK ACADEMY 6-12
Madison Park Academy 6-12 is a Title I public high school that is part of the Oakland Unified school district, located in Oakland, CA with about 772 students offering grade levels from 6th Grade to 12th Grade. Student demographics can be found below.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 43 teachers, Madison Park Academy 6-12 has a student/teacher ratio of about 17: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. Madison Park Academy (MPA) is a public secondary school located in the East Oakland neighborhood of California, serving students in grades 6 through 12. As a combined middle and high school, it offers a unique "longitudinal" educational environment where students can remain in the same school community for seven years. The school is part of the Oakland Unified School District and is situated within the Elmhurst neighborhood, focusing on providing college and career readiness opportunities to a diverse student population.
Academically, Madison Park Academy emphasizes a rigorous curriculum designed to prepare students for post-secondary success. The school often incorporates project-based learning and career-themed pathways, aiming to bridge the gap between classroom instruction and real-world application. Beyond academics, the school fosters a tight-knit campus culture, leveraging its 6-12 structure to allow older students to serve as mentors to younger peers, creating a supportive community environment aimed at student retention and personal growth.

School Demographics for 772 students
The primary ethnicity of students attending MADISON PARK ACADEMY 6-12 is predominantly Hispanic/Latino, representing about 82% of the student body.
- Hispanic/Latino
- 81.9%
- Black or African American
- 13.3%
- Asian
- 1.6%
- Two or more races
- 1.2%
- Native Hawaiian or Other Pacific Islander
- 1.0%
- White
- 0.9%
- American Indian or Alaska Native
- 0.1%
- Female
- 47.7%
- Male
- 52.3%
